Quick Summary
The Defense Logistics Agency (DLA) Aviation is conducting market research through a Sources Sought notice for the new manufacture of NSN 5315-010969169, PIN,STRAIGHT,HEADED. This effort aims to identify potential sources capable of supplying an estimated 1,708 units. Responses are due by May 13, 2026.
Scope of Work
Potential sources must be capable of furnishing all labor, materials, facilities, and equipment for the new manufacture of the specified item. This includes procurement/manufacture of component parts, inspection, testing, preservation/packaging, and shipping. Additionally, responsibilities may extend to supply chain management, logistics planning, forecasting production requirements, long-lead time parts procurement, and addressing diminishing manufacturing sources and material shortage issues. The current approved sources are SIKORSKY AIRCRAFT CORPORATION (P/N 70104-08015-102) and AVIBANK MFG., INC. (P/N ADB216-102).

Evaluation
Responses will be evaluated to ascertain potential market capacity to: 1) provide services consistent with the described scope; 2) secure and apply necessary corporate resources; 3) implement a successful project management plan; and 4) provide services under a performance-based service acquisition contract.
Additional Notes
This notice does not constitute a request for proposals, and the government assumes no financial responsibility for costs incurred by respondents. Drawings, technical orders, and qualification requirements are not available at this time. Companies wishing to become an "Approved Source" must submit an application package through the Source Approval Request (SAR) Program, as outlined in the attached JACG SAM HB document. SAR packages must be submitted via a DoDSafe link, which can be requested by emailing dlaavnsmallbus@dla.mil with the subject line "Request a SAR drop off", including CAGE code, NSN, and email address.
